Technical Field
The utility model belongs to container equipment field, concretely relates to open top door and seal structure on container.
Background
The top of the existing open-top container is mostly provided with a tarpaulin top cover, so that the operation is complex, hoisting equipment cannot be effectively utilized, the tarpaulin top is easy to damage and fall off, the wet damage of goods is caused, the railway driving safety is seriously endangered, and the redesign is needed to improve the loading and unloading efficiency and the use safety.

Detailed Description
The following describes in detail embodiments of the present invention with reference to the accompanying drawings and examples.
The first embodiment is as follows:
as shown in fig. 1, the split top door and the sealing structure thereof on the container comprise a top door, wherein the top door is composed of a left top cover 1 and a right top cover 1 which are butted by the middle, the top cover 1 slides to two sides by adopting screw rod transmission to realize split opening, and concretely comprises a connecting seat 2, a sliding block 3, a driven shaft 4 and a driving shaft 5, the two ends of the top cover 1 are provided with connecting seats 2, the connecting seats 2 are provided with long holes and hinged on support shafts 31, the support shafts 31 are fixed on sliding blocks 3, the sliding blocks 3 are arranged on vertical driven shafts 4 on the side surfaces of the container and realize up-and-down movement by adopting screw rod transmission, a driving shaft 5 which is vertically arranged with the driven shafts 4 is arranged below the driven shafts 4, the driving shaft 5 and the driven shafts 4 on the two sides are transmitted by adopting bevel gears 6, the driven shaft 4 is installed outside the container body through a fixing seat 41, the driving shaft 5 is installed outside the container body through a fixing seat 52, and the end part of the driving shaft 5 can be driven by a motor or manually driven by a rotating handle 7.
As shown in fig. 3, notches are arranged on the end surfaces of the two sides of the top cover 1, guide rollers 11 are arranged in the notches, and the guide rollers 11 are hinged on the container body through connecting rods 12.
The upper section of the driven shaft 4 adopts a screw rod, the lower section of the driven shaft is a polished rod, fixing seats 41 are arranged at two ends of the driven shaft 4 and the joint of the screw rod and the polished rod, the length of the screw rod is larger than the width of the top cover 1, and the top cover 1 can be finally and completely placed on the side face of the box body after being turned.
The driving shaft 5 is connected by the middle coupling 51 by adopting two sections of shafts, and the strength of the driving shaft 5 can be ensured by adopting two ends of shafts because the side wall of the container is longer.
Bearings are arranged in the fixed seats 41 and 52, so that the driving shaft 5 and the driven shaft 4 can rotate smoothly.
Concretely, through rotating drive shaft 5 by bevel gear 6 transmission to the driven shaft 4 of both sides, driven shaft 4 drives slider 3 through the lead screw drive and moves down along the lead screw to connecting seat 2 drives top cap 1 along with slider 3's counter roll 31 and overturns to the outside, by the box lateral wall lapse down at last, and finally top cap 1 is opened completely and is receive and release in the lateral wall outside of container, occupation space not, makes things convenient for the staff to load and unload goods. The utility model discloses can adopt motor drive or manual drive, the both sides top cap is to open each other not influencing, can open, close in step or separately operate, opens and shuts the convenience.
As shown in fig. 5, a sealing structure of a split top door on a container comprises a seal between a top cover 1 and a top side beam 100 of the container and a seal between a left top cover and a right top cover, wherein a first section bar 200 is arranged above the inner side of the top side beam 100, a second section bar 15 is arranged at the outer end of the top cover 1, a primary rainproof rubber sheet 151 which vertically faces downwards is arranged at the outer end of the second section bar 15 and is connected to the top side beam 100, a horizontal support plate 16 and a D-type secondary rainproof rubber strip 152 which is positioned below the support plate 16 are arranged at the inner side of the second section bar 15, a second D-type secondary rainproof rubber strip 153 which rotates downwards by 90 degrees is arranged on the support plate 16, and the D-type secondary rainproof rubber strip 152 and the second D-type secondary rainproof; the rain-proof rubber roof is characterized in that a third section bar 14 is arranged on the inner side of the left top cover, a second primary rain-proof rubber sheet 141 is arranged at the top of the third section bar 14, a third D-shaped second-stage rain-proof rubber strip 142 and a water diversion plate 143 below the third D-shaped second-stage rain-proof rubber strip 142 are arranged on the side face of the third section bar 14, a fourth section bar 17 is arranged on the inner side of the right top cover, a fifth section bar 171 connected with the third D-shaped second-stage rain-proof rubber strip 142 is arranged on the side face of the fourth section bar 17, a water.
The left and right top covers are respectively arranged symmetrically with the seal between the container top side beams 100.
The rain-proof rubber sheet and the rain-proof rubber strip are made of soft materials and are fixed on the section bar or the support plate through gluing.
The section bar adopts a square tube.
The utility model discloses a rain-proof adhesive tape of elementary rain-proof rubber cooperation D type second grade realizes the sealed of run-on top door, and sealing performance is good.
Example two:
as shown in fig. 6, 7 and 8, the top cover of the side-by-side opening top door on a container can also slide to two sides by chain transmission to realize side-by-side opening, and specifically comprises a connecting shaft 20, a chain 30, a driven sprocket 40, a driving sprocket 50 and a driving shaft 60, wherein two sides of the top cover 1 are respectively provided with two connecting shafts 20, the connecting shafts 20 are respectively fixed at two ends of the chain 30, the chain 30 is installed on the driven sprocket 40 and the driving sprocket 50 to form a closed chain, the driven sprocket 40 is fixed on a shaft of a support 401, the driving sprocket 50 is installed at two ends of the driving shaft 60, the support 401 is fixed on a header plate at the top side of the container, the driving shaft 60 is fixed on a side body of the container through a bearing seat 601, the chain 30 is provided with an upper supporting wheel 70 and a lower supporting wheel set at a corner of the container, the wheel sets comprise a first supporting wheel set, the middle part or the end part of the driving shaft 60 is provided with a reduction gearbox 602, and the reduction gearbox 602 can be driven by a motor or a handle manually.
As shown in fig. 11, 12 and 13, the driving shaft 60 rotates, so that the driving chain wheel 50 drives the chain 30 to rotate, the top cover 1 is driven to translate outwards along the top through the connecting shaft 20, when the connecting shaft 20 of the top cover 1 is positioned at the corner of the top of the container, the top cover 1 starts to turn over, the top cover 1 turns over to a vertical state from a horizontal state, the chain 30 continues to rotate, the top cover 1 vertically moves downwards under the action of the chain 30, and finally the top cover 1 is completely opened and is stored outside the side wall of the container.
